I had it installed at last year's international by the guy who sets up a trailer
at the rally. (would have to look up his name, but many A/S's have been done by
him at previous rallies and he was highly recommended) It cost about $2000 and
that included all the equipment and installation. (two batteries, two panels,
inverter, etc.) He put the batteries and inverter under my couch in the front of
the trailer. He did a great job, you can't see anything like wires. When he was
done I was able to use the hairdryer and finally have a good hair day at the
rally!!!!
I've been ecstatic about the installation! On the road I now don't care where I
stop for a quick night. I've even stayed at truck stops and Walmarts since I can
use all my appliances. It doesn't require any setup at all. I just flick a
switch to use the solar power. I've never run it down, the two batteries last
forever. When I pull over for the night I just get out of the truck and into the
trailer and I'm all set. Especially nice in nasty weather. No setting up a
generator and worrying that someone will steal it!!
